## Authentication

The Glintmap tile-rendering cache accepts requests only from services holding a valid internal credential, verified on every call before any cached tile is served. Anonymous reads are rejected at the edge, and credentials are scoped to read-only cache operations. For review purposes, the staging environment authenticates with the key that follows immediately below this section.

app token of bawep-hafog = kto7_vwrmnlx

## Garagio Occupancy Feed — Restart Procedure

If the occupancy feed for the Delver Street garage stalls, check the sensor gateway first, then restart the aggregator. Counts resync within two minutes; do not manually edit tallies. If the feed stays flat after restart, escalate to on-call infra. Before restarting, confirm the service is running with the following configuration.

settings of yageg-yahap:
[gorael]
team = olieth
access_code = ac_941d74
owner = brieth.aldiel
host = gorael.tolvaqio.internal
port = 6379
peer = briwyn.urlaqtech.internal
salt = 116e6622
pin = 1957

**Alert: PicklaneOptimizerDegraded**

This alert fires when the Picklane route optimizer falls back to naive aisle ordering for more than five minutes, usually because a plugin's cost function timed out or returned invalid weights. Plugin authors should verify their cost hooks complete within the 200ms budget and return finite values. Guidance on hook timeouts, validation rules, and debugging traces is published here.

runbook for badug-kadup: https://confluence.zemvarlabs.internal/projects/browse/display/projects/bd1b

Welcome to the Crumbline team! Quick heads-up before the weekly sync: our bakery partners on the Ovenly platform have a hard order cutoff at 2pm local time. Anything submitted after that rolls to the next day, no exceptions — the fulfillment queue literally locks. If you're testing order flows, use the sandbox store so you don't trip the cutoff logic. To hit the sandbox, authenticate against the Proofbox service with the key below.

app token of yajeg-kawef = kto11_7En3XSX8xQw